PAGCOR allocates 100 million pesos to support Northern Ilocos in building a world-class sports training center.

The Philippine Amusement and Gaming Corporation (PAGCOR) officially allocated 100 million Philippine pesos (approximately 1.74 million US dollars) to the government of Ilocos Norte Province to support the construction of the Ilocos Norte Sports Academy and Research (INSPIRE) Training Development Center and dormitory facilities.

This allocation was transferred by Danilo Tejano, the manager of PAGCOR's Ilocos Norte branch, and was received on behalf of the governor Matthew Manotoc by senior board member Rafael Medina during the ceremony. The INSPIRE project is a provincial key infrastructure with an overall budget estimated at 400 million pesos, aimed at serving athletes from northern Luzon by providing integrated support in training, research, and accommodation.

Once completed, INSPIRE will become a regional hub for nurturing sports talents and conducting sports science research, promoting the simultaneous development of grassroots and elite sports, and bringing continuous social benefits to the Ilocos Norte community.

Alejandro H. Tengco, the Chairman and CEO of PAGCOR, stated: "This project is not only about empowering athletes but also investing in the future of the younger generation and the community, marking a crucial step towards sustainable sports development."

This funding also aligns with PAGCOR's recent expansion of public service projects, including medical and military education among other areas, reflecting its active role in reinvesting gambling revenues into social infrastructure.
